Skilled Insights: Key Inquiries to Ask Before Hiring a Building Firm

Hiring a development company for your project is a significant determination that can drastically impact its success. Whether or not you are planning a small renovation or a large-scale construction project, discovering the precise company is essential. With numerous options available, it’s essential to ask the appropriate questions to make sure you’re making an informed choice. Here are some professional insights into the questions you need to ask before hiring a building company.

What is Your Expertise in This Type of Project?
Start by understanding the development firm’s expertise with projects similar to yours. Inquire about their track record, together with past projects, their scale, and complicatedity. An organization with relevant experience is more likely to understand the distinctive challenges of your project and deliver satisfactory results.

Are You Licensed and Insured?
Make sure that the construction company holds all essential licenses and permits required to your project. Additionally, inquire about their insurance coverage, including general liability and worker’s compensation insurance. Working with a licensed and insured firm provides protection and peace of mind all through the construction process.

Can You Provide References or Portfolio of Past Work?
Request references from earlier shoppers or ask for a portfolio showcasing their accomplished projects. This allows you to consider the quality of their workmanship, attention to element, and adherence to deadlines. Speaking directly with past purchasers can supply valuable insights into their experiences working with the company.

What’s Your Project Timeline and Availability?
Understand the development company’s availability and projected timeline to your project. Clarify milestones, deadlines, and any potential delays that will arise. Clear communication concerning timelines helps manage expectations and ensures well timed completion of the project.

How Do You Handle Project Communication and Updates?
Efficient communication is essential for a profitable development project. Inquire about the firm’s communication protocols, together with how they provide updates, address issues, and handle change orders. Establishing clear lines of communication from the outset fosters transparency and minimizes misunderstandings.

What’s Your Approach to Price range Management?
Talk about the development company’s approach to finances management, including price estimation, payment schedules, and handling sudden expenses or change orders. A transparent and organized budgeting process helps forestall value overruns and ensures monetary accountability.

Who Will Be Overseeing the Project Onsite?
Clarify who will be managing the project onsite and their level of containment. Understanding the project manager’s qualifications, experience, and communication model is crucial for effective coordination and problem-fixing throughout construction.

Do You Work with Subcontractors?
Many development firms work with subcontractors for specialized tasks resembling electrical work or plumbing. Inquire concerning the firm’s subcontractor relationships, together with their qualifications, licensing, and insurance coverage. Be certain that all parties concerned meet your standards for professionalism and expertise.

What is Your Safety Record and Protocols?
Safety should always be a top priority on any development site. Ask concerning the company’s safety record, training programs, and protocols for maintaining a safe work environment. A commitment to safety demonstrates professionalism and helps forestall accidents or injuries during the project.

What Sets Your Company Apart from Others?
Finally, ask the construction company to highlight what sets them apart from competitors. Whether it’s their commitment to quality, attention to element, or revolutionary approaches, understanding their distinctive strengths can assist you make a more informed decision.

In conclusion, asking the appropriate questions earlier than hiring a construction firm is essential for ensuring a successful project outcome. By gaining insights into their experience, qualifications, communication processes, and approach to project management, you possibly can make a well-informed choice that meets your needs and expectations. Keep in mind, thorough due diligence upfront can save time, cash, and headaches down the road.
